To find the ratio of fiction books to nonfiction books that Kai buys, we look at the numbers given: 6 fiction books and 4 nonfiction books.
The ratio can be calculated as follows:
Ratio = Number of fiction books : Number of nonfiction books
Ratio = 6 : 4
Now, we can simplify this ratio. Both 6 and 4 can be divided by their greatest common divisor, which is 2:
6 ÷ 2 = 3
4 ÷ 2 = 2
So the simplified ratio is:
3 : 2
Therefore, the correct response is:
**3:2** (3 colon 2)
